From 6fda4c136de2a0036e460ef00f60416caabb3ed9 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Liang-Chi Hsieh Date: Fri, 6 Feb 2015 11:22:11 -0800 Subject: [SPARK-5652][Mllib] Use broadcasted weights in LogisticRegressionModel `LogisticRegressionModel`'s `predictPoint` should directly use broadcasted weights. This pr also fixes the compilation errors of two unit test suite: `JavaLogisticRegressionSuite ` and `JavaLinearRegressionSuite`.
